SANTA MONICA, Calif. (Top40 Charts/ Latin Recording Academy) - Two-time Latin GRAMMY winner Beto Cuevas, singer/songwriter Shaila Durcal, salsa singer Luis Enrique, singer/songwriter Luis Fonsi, actor and Latin Recording Academy Trustee Ad Honorem Andy Garcia, singer/songwriter Luz Rios, comedian and past Latin GRAMMY presenter Paul Rodriguez, Emmy Award winner Jimmy Smits and urban artist Tito "El Bambino" will help announce nominations for the 10th Annual Latin GRAMMYs.
Gabriel Abaroa, President of The Latin Recording Academy, popular Univision personality Giselle Blondet, and key members of the music industry and cultural community will be in attendance.

Thursday, Sept. 17, 2009
7:15 a.m. PT Media Check-In (***Photo I.D. required.***)
8:30 a.m. PT (SHARP!) Press Conference Begins

The Conga Room at L.A. LIVE
800 West Olympic Blvd.
Suite A160
Los Angeles, CA 90015

The 10th Annual Latin GRAMMY Awards will be broadcast live on the Univision Network (8 p.m. Eastern/7 p.m. Central) from the Mandalay Bay Events Center in Las Vegas on Nov. 5. For more information, please visit www.latingrammy.com.
